Help with Armrest Part Number

My wife has a 2006 CLK 350 Cabriolet. Her lockable armrest broke, so we need to replace the part that has the cushion and the lock. I have searched all of the OEM parts websites, and I even took the car to my local Mercedes dealer.
They used her VIN number to look up parts for her car, and gave me a part number, so I paid for it and paid to have it shipped to Hawaii, and it was not correct. It was one that "rolled back" (part number 209-680-61-07-9E24 ) which was incorrect.
Can anyone please look at the photo in this thread and tell me the part number I need to order? It's the cushion with the lock and there's 2 side levers to open the top part one way, and one large front lever to open the whole thing to get into the deeper box below.

I am not 100% certain, but I believe the part is A2096804939 (plus the 4-digit color code). That's what I find in EPC for the "armrest". That part is for cars with cell phone pre-wiring and TeleAid. Without those, it's A2096802682.
